How do I merge two or more penalties?

Occasionally a situation occurs when multiple penalties exist within the LeagueStat.com database that represent one penalty in the league rulebook.

If one of the penalty options has never been used before (a scorekeeper has not associated it to any games played) it can be deleted by clicking the red delete icon on the right side of the page.

If the penalty code has been used in a game, you'll need to open an email ticket with HockeyTech support to have these merged. Please indicate which penalty option you'd like to keep, and which penalty option you need removed from the database.
